Overview of Graham Reception & Classification Center
Graham Reception & Classification Center, located in Hillsboro, Illinois, serves as a primary intake facility for male inmates in Illinois. It is responsible for the reception, classification, and evaluation of all male offenders committed to the Illinois Department of Corrections. This facility processes new inmates, providing medical screening, risk assessment, and assignment to permanent correctional facilities.

How to Locate an Inmate
The Illinois Department of Corrections offers an online inmate locator service that can be used to find inmates at the Graham Reception & Classification Center. Visit the IDOC Inmate Search page and enter the required information to locate an inmate.
Visitation Information and Hours
Visitation hours at Graham Reception & Classification Center are subject to change, so it's crucial to verify with the facility before planning a visit. Typically, visitations are allowed on weekends and state holidays. All visitors must be approved in advance and adhere to the facility's dress code and guidelines.
How to Send Money
Family and friends can send money to inmates via electronic payments through JPay or ConnectNetwork. Visit JPay or ConnectNetwork to create an account and transfer funds using the inmate's ID number.
Phone Calls and Video Options
Inmates at Graham Reception & Classification Center can make outgoing phone calls using the system provided by Securus Technologies. To set up an account or schedule video visitations, visit Securus Technologies.
